Q: Is 8,064,875 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 8,064,875 is a composite number.

Why is 8,064,875 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 8,064,875 can be evenly divided by 1 5 7 13 25 35 65 91 125 175 325 455 709 875 1,625 2,275 3,545 4,963 9,217 11,375 17,725 24,815 46,085 64,519 88,625 124,075 230,425 322,595 620,375 1,152,125 1,612,975 and 8,064,875, with no remainder.

Since 8,064,875 cannot be divided by just 1 and 8,064,875, it is a composite number.
